# Replica-lag alarm config — Quillbrook DB tier

# This file drives the Lagwatch monitor for the Ostermere read replicas.
# Threshold is seconds of replication delay before paging; keep it above
# 30 to avoid noise during nightly vacuum windows. Lagwatch posts alarms
# to the internal pager bridge, which authenticates with the token set
# on the next line.

env line for fafof-fahag: LEDGER_TOKEN5=f8790

Order of checks: BOM, declared charset header, then statistical detection via the Fennelgate library. Anything below 80% confidence is tagged `encoding:uncertain` and routed to the review queue — do not force-convert these. We normalize everything to UTF-8 before storage; original bytes are kept for 30 days. Common gotchas: Shift-JIS misdetected as Latin-1, and zero-byte files crashing older parsers. The full decision table and override flags are on the internal page below.

wiki page, fahaf-yagag: https://confluence.qorvellabs.internal/pages/display/pages/display

## Rebalancer v2 for PedalPool

Hey on-call — this reworks the PedalPool rebalancing planner so truck routes get recomputed when a station crosses its empty/full threshold instead of on a fixed timer. Should cut the 3am "dock full" pages roughly in half. If the planner misbehaves, flip `REBALANCE_LEGACY_MODE` and it falls back to the old timer loop, no restart needed. Watch the `planner_lag` dashboard for the first few nights. The thresholds it keys off are defined below.

constants for tafog-kahag:
RATE_LIMITS = {
    "sorir": 697,
    "oliox": 683,
    "holax": 176,
    "casox": 60,
    "pelius": 382,
}

Management Meeting Minutes — Regional Sales Review

Present: M. Arlett, D. Kovane, S. Pruell. Q3 sales for the Veldmark region down 6% against plan; Harlow district flat. Kovane flagged discounting on the Tessira line as the main drag. Actions: Arlett to tighten rebate approvals; Pruell to resubmit territory targets by Friday. Finance to reconcile commission accruals before month-end close. The following note is confidential and for finance eyes only.

internal memo for yajef-tajeg: The renewal with Ralaelek Group closes at $2 million a year, 15 percent above the last contract. Project Zorix slips by two quarters because of the tooling delay.